What Parents Need to Know About Age 7 Screenings

Direct Answer: The American Association of Orthodontists recommends every child receive an orthodontic screening by age 7. At this age, we can identify jaw growth discrepancies, airway issues, and crowding before they become severe. Early interceptive treatment often prevents the need for jaw surgery or extractions later.

Parents in Pembroke Pines, Cooper City, and Davie frequently ask me when they should bring their child in for the first visit.

Age 7 is not arbitrary.

By this age, the first permanent molars have erupted, establishing the bite.

The jaw is still growing, which means we can guide development rather than correct problems after growth has stopped.

I have caught severe crossbites, narrow palates causing airway restriction, and impacted canines in seven-year-olds that would have required surgical intervention if we had waited until age 13.

Airway Health: The Connection Most Orthodontists Miss

Direct Answer: Narrow palates and retruded jaws do not just affect your smile. They restrict your airway, contributing to snoring, sleep apnea, and poor oxygen saturation during sleep. At SMILE-FX, every comprehensive consultation includes a CBCT airway assessment when clinically indicated, evaluating the full oropharyngeal space rather than just tooth position.

A parent brings their seven-year-old in for crowded teeth.

They also mention the child snores like a freight train.

Most offices ignore that second part.

They focus on the crooked teeth and miss the airway restriction that is silently affecting that child's brain development, school performance, and growth.

A narrow upper jaw does not just crowd teeth.

It pushes the nasal floor upward, reducing the space available for breathing.

That child becomes a mouth breather.

Mouth breathing changes facial growth patterns.

The face grows longer and narrower.

The airway stays compromised into adulthood.

This is why we use 3D CBCT imaging for kids showing signs of sleep-disordered breathing.

We measure the actual airway volume in cubic millimeters.

We look at the adenoids and tonsils.

When we expand the palate during growth using a palatal expander, we are doing two things at once: making room for teeth and opening the airway.

Parents in Pembroke Pines and Cooper City often tell me their child stopped snoring within weeks of starting expansion.

That is not a coincidence.

It is what happens when treatment addresses the root cause instead of just the cosmetic symptom.

Adults benefit from this approach too.

Many adult patients with undiagnosed sleep apnea have mandibles that are set back, reducing the posterior airway space.

Orthodontic treatment coordinated with airway evaluation can be life-changing, not just smile-changing.

Digital Smile Design: Planning Your Result Before Treatment Starts

Direct Answer: Digital Smile Design allows patients to see a simulation of their final smile before committing to treatment. Co-Founder Dr. Alex, a credentialed Fellow of the International Academy for Dental-Facial Esthetics and expert Digital Smile Designer, collaborates with Dr. Liang on complex esthetic cases to ensure the result enhances the full face, not just the teeth.

Teeth do not exist in isolation.

They sit within lips, framed by cheeks, supported by bone, and they affect how your entire face looks when you smile, speak, and laugh.

Too many orthodontic treatments end with straight teeth that somehow do not look right in the patient's face.

The smile arc is flat.

The buccal corridors are too wide.

The incisor display at rest is off.

These are esthetic considerations that require training beyond standard orthodontics.

The International Academy for Dental-Facial Esthetics Fellowship that both Dr. Liang and Dr. Alex hold is a credential fewer than 1% of orthodontists in the United States possess.

It represents advanced training in how orthodontic tooth movement affects overall facial esthetics.

Traditional Braces vs Invisalign: The Real Comparison Nobody Gives You

Direct Answer: Traditional braces use metal or ceramic brackets bonded to teeth with wires that apply constant pressure. Clear aligners like Invisalign use removable plastic trays changed every one to two weeks. Braces handle complex cases better. Aligners offer discretion and easier cleaning. The right choice depends on your specific bite problem, lifestyle, and compliance habits.

I get asked the traditional braces vs Invisalign question at least five times a day.

And most of what you read online skips the parts that actually matter.

Braces are not old technology that clear aligners replaced.

They are different tools for different problems.

If you have a severe overbite, a deep bite, multiple rotated teeth, or extractions in your treatment plan, traditional braces give me control that aligners simply cannot match.

The wire runs through every bracket and I can make micro-adjustments at each visit.

Aligners depend on you wearing them 22 hours a day.

If you are disciplined, they work beautifully for mild to moderate cases.

If you are not, treatment drags on and results suffer.

For adults in Aventura, Brickell, or Boca who want discretion, clear aligners and Invisalign are the obvious move.

Nobody knows you are in treatment.

You can eat whatever you want.

You can brush and floss normally.

But here is what the commercials do not tell you.

Aligners require discipline.

Every time you eat or drink anything other than water, you need to brush before putting them back in.

If you are a grazer or a coffee sipper, that gets old fast.

Braces are fixed.

They work 24/7 whether you think about them or not.

For a thirteen-year-old who might lose a retainer every other week, braces are often the safer bet.

For a thirty-year-old professional closing a gap before a wedding, aligners are usually the answer.

SureSmile and Tech-Driven Orthodontics: Why Speed and Precision Are Linked

Direct Answer: SureSmile is an advanced orthodontic system that uses 3D imaging and robotic wire-bending technology to create custom archwires with sub-millimeter precision. Combined with AI bracket placement, this technology reduces treatment time and the number of adjustment visits.
